Grid Forecast says "No Location Available" - SOLVED

So I had this problem, where I would open the Home app on my iPhone and there's a "Grid Forecast" feature that would say "No Location Available". I wanted to see the forecast, and I live in California so the feature is supported here.


In Location Services, the Home app already had permission to use my precise location, so that wasn't the issue. And my Contacts card for "me" has my correct address. These two things were suggested as potential sources of trouble in other forums, but neither solved the problem for me.


Well, I found a solution. Looking at Settings->Privacy & Security->Location Services->System Services->HomeKit, location services was disabled for HomeKit. Turned this on and Grid Forecast now works!


This was probably turned off by me a long time ago when I turned off location services for everything I wasn't using, just to increase privacy, and then of course I forgot all about it. It sure would be helpful if Apple could provide feedback within the app to indicate what setting was causing the problem, but I imagine this is a rare problem because I bet very few people ever turn any of these settings off.
